The Solana HFT infrastructure stack
High-frequency trading on Solana in 2026 is defined by navigating specific latency and sequencing bottlenecks that standard RPCs introduce. The baseline infrastructure has shifted from generic node access to specialized data streaming and ephemeral rollup solutions. This transition is driven by the Yellowstone upgrade’s increased block production rates and the rise of dedicated HFT providers like MagicBlock, which offer sub-50ms latency and first-come-first-served (FCFS) sequencing.

Standard RPC endpoints often batch transactions or route them through shared mempools, introducing unpredictable delays. For strategies relying on arbitrage or front-running, these milliseconds determine profit or slippage. Specialized infrastructure providers solve this by offering direct node access, custom gRPC endpoints, and dedicated transaction submission pipelines that bypass public congestion points. This allows traders to submit transactions with precise priority fees and guaranteed ordering.
Beyond the RPC layer, ephemeral rollup technology is critical. Solutions like MagicBlock allow HFT firms to execute trades with CEX-like speed while settling on Solana. These rollups provide predictable costs and deterministic sequencing, essential for complex multi-leg strategies. Without this infrastructure, the variability of Solana’s block times and network congestion makes consistent high-frequency execution nearly impossible.
Comparing Solana DEX liquidity pools
For high-frequency trading, the choice of decentralized exchange impacts infrastructure latency and routing efficiency. In 2026, the Solana ecosystem is dominated by three primary liquidity layers: Jupiter, Raydium, and Orca. Each handles order execution differently, impacting slippage and fill rates for automated strategies.
Jupiter acts as the primary liquidity aggregator, using proprietary algorithms to split orders across multiple venues to minimize slippage on large volumes. Raydium, built on the OpenBook order book, offers deeper direct liquidity for specific pairs but requires complex routing logic to avoid fragmentation. Orca focuses on concentrated liquidity ranges, which can offer tighter spreads for stable pairs but may suffer from higher slippage during volatile market moves if ranges aren't managed correctly.
The following comparison breaks down the critical infrastructure metrics for each platform.
| Platform | Avg. Latency | Maker/Taker Fees | Liquidity Depth |
|---|---|---|---|
| Jupiter | ~400ms | 0.25% / 0.25% | Aggregated (Highest) |
| Raydium | ~600ms | 0.30% / 0.30% | Deep (OpenBook) |
| Orca | ~500ms | 0.30% / 0.30% | Moderate (Whirlpool) |
Jupiter’s aggregated model generally provides the lowest effective slippage for HFT strategies by dynamically routing through Raydium, Orca, and other venues, though this incurs slight latency overhead. Raydium’s direct connection to OpenBook offers lower latency for high-volume trades on specific pairs, making it a strong contender for pure speed-focused bots. Orca’s Whirlpool model is efficient for stablecoin trading but may require more frequent rebalancing for volatile assets.
For most HFT strategies, Jupiter’s routing efficiency outweighs its slight latency disadvantage. The ability to split orders across multiple liquidity pools reduces the risk of partial fills and price impact. Raydium remains essential for bots targeting specific high-volume pairs where direct order book access is critical. Orca is best suited for stablecoin arbitrage or strategies that benefit from concentrated liquidity ranges.
Build the execution bot architecture
Building a high-frequency trading bot on Solana is less about writing clever algorithms and more about engineering a system that survives latency. In 2026, the margin for error has vanished. Yellowstone upgrades and MagicBlock infrastructure have raised the baseline speed, meaning your bot must operate with microsecond precision to capture arbitrage or front-run opportunities before they vanish.
The foundation of this architecture is language choice. Rust remains the non-negotiable standard for Solana HFT. Its memory safety guarantees and lack of garbage collection pauses allow for deterministic execution times that Python or JavaScript simply cannot match. When competing against other bots, a few milliseconds of garbage collection overhead is the difference between profit and a failed transaction.
Connection handling is the next critical layer. Your bot needs to maintain persistent WebSocket connections to the network, subscribing to account updates and slot notifications. This allows you to react to state changes in real-time rather than polling. You must also handle reconnection logic gracefully; a dropped connection for even a second can result in stale data and significant financial loss.
Finally, MEV protection is mandatory. Sending transactions directly to the public mempool exposes your orders to sandwich attacks. Instead, integrate with Jito bundles. This allows you to bundle your transaction with a tip to validators, ensuring your trade executes atomically and privately. Without this, you are essentially broadcasting your strategy to every other participant in the market.
Risk management and the 3-5-7 rule
High-frequency trading on Solana moves fast, but speed without guardrails is a liability. The 3-5-7 rule provides a structured framework to limit exposure during the inevitable volatility spikes common in DeFi protocols. This approach prevents a single bad trade from wiping out weeks of alpha.
The rule sets three distinct loss thresholds that act as circuit breakers for your algorithm. First, limit losses to 3% per individual trade. This caps the damage of a single execution error or slippage event. Second, restrict total drawdown to 5% per position. If a position trends against you, this hard stop forces a liquidation before the position becomes toxic. Third, enforce a 7% maximum loss across the entire portfolio. When the total portfolio hits this threshold, all trading activity pauses until the system resets.
Applying these limits requires infrastructure that can react instantly. On Solana, this means leveraging low-latency nodes and optimized execution paths. Tools like MagicBlock’s infrastructure allow for precise control over transaction timing, ensuring that stop-loss orders execute before the market moves further against you. Without this speed, the 3-5-7 rule is just a suggestion, not a protection.
Implementing these rules isn't just about code; it's about discipline. The 3-5-7 framework forces you to respect the market's unpredictability. By capping losses at each level, you preserve capital for the next high-probability setup. In a market where gas wars and MEV bots compete for every block, survival depends on strict risk parameters, not just aggressive entry strategies.
Essential tools for Solana traders
High-frequency trading on Solana demands infrastructure that minimizes latency and maximizes reliability. The Yellowstone upgrade and MagicBlock’s parallel execution capabilities have raised the bar for what constitutes a professional setup. You need hardware and software that can handle the network’s speed without becoming the bottleneck.
Hardware and software essentials
A multi-monitor setup is non-negotiable for tracking real-time order books and charting. Pair this with a mechanical keyboard for rapid hotkey execution and a hardware wallet like Ledger or Trezor to secure your private keys. For software, you need a low-latency node RPC provider and a trading terminal that supports Solana’s unique transaction structure.

Recommended gear for trading setups
As an Amazon Associate, we may earn from qualifying purchases.
Software for execution
Your software stack should prioritize speed and security. Use a dedicated RPC node to avoid rate limits and ensure consistent block propagation. Pair this with a trading bot or terminal that integrates with Jupiter or Raydium for optimal swap routing. Always keep your firmware and software updated to mitigate security risks.
Frequently asked questions about Solana HFT
How does the 3-5-7 rule work for Solana HFT? The 3-5-7 rule limits losses to 3% per trade, 5% per position, and 7% across the total portfolio. This framework helps traders maintain discipline during high-volatility periods by acting as circuit breakers for automated strategies.
Which Solana DEX is best for HFT? Jupiter is generally preferred for its aggregated liquidity and routing efficiency, minimizing slippage. Raydium offers lower latency for specific pairs via OpenBook, while Orca is suitable for stablecoin arbitrage using concentrated liquidity ranges.
Why is Jito integration necessary for Solana HFT? Jito integration protects trades from MEV (Maximal Extractable Value) attacks like sandwiching by bundling transactions with tips to validators. This ensures atomic execution and privacy, which is critical for maintaining edge in high-frequency strategies.



No comments yet. Be the first to share your thoughts!